The Elimination of the Squeeze Phase

In standard baccarat formats, tension is deliberately built by revealing cards slowly or allowing players to squeeze the physical edges. Fast variants completely eliminate this dramatic pause by dealing all cards face-up instantly after the betting window closes. Experienced players note that this structural change removes emotional anticipation, transforming the game into a purely analytical sequence of outcomes.

By stripping away the theatrical elements, the game moves with mechanical precision from start to finish. This streamlined reveal system ensures that statistical outcomes are resolved within seconds rather than minutes. For veteran participants, this means focus must remain strictly on table tracking rather than atmospheric build-up.

Compressed Decision Windows and Cognitive Load

Another defining aspect of the rapid baccarat framework is the significantly truncated betting interval. Players typically have less than fifteen seconds to evaluate past roadmaps, decide on stake sizing, and confirm their selection. Managing this quick operational cycle requires higher mental clarity and a pre-planned strategy before sitting down.

Scoreboard Dynamics and Pattern Perception

Tracking historical trends on scoreboards like the Big Road or Bead Plate becomes a vastly different exercise when rounds conclude rapidly. Because new entries fill the grid at double the standard frequency, trend lines appear to form and dissolve much faster. Experienced observers understand that while the visual density increases, the independent probability of each hand remains identical.

Recognizing this distinction protects seasoned players from falling into cognitive traps such as chasing false streaks. They view the accelerated scoreboard as a rapid chronological record rather than a predictive engine. Maintaining this objective perspective prevents reactionary shifts in betting behavior during volatile swings.

Bankroll Preservation in High-Velocity Formats

The accelerated cadence of rapid baccarat directly impacts financial exposure over any given timeframe. Playing twice as many hands per hour naturally doubles the variance experienced within a single session. Experienced players adjust to this reality by tightening their unit stake sizes relative to their total bankroll.

Establishing strict loss thresholds and profit targets becomes even more vital when round progression is continuous. By structuring shorter playing windows, veterans ensure that high velocity does not compromise their financial discipline.
